Output ffa91669c75ceb0a3efff53a554b3960f9726de96f50f13623b9d0c134e386e4:20

value
565864
script pubkey
OP_0 OP_PUSHBYTES_32 23d145ffe8111403026491cf781c18954dc4750bc8b177cf6a3af5e4d8acef23
address
bc1qy0g5tllgzy2qxqnyj88hs8qcj4xugagtezch0nm28t67fk9vau3sa4cea5
transaction
ffa91669c75ceb0a3efff53a554b3960f9726de96f50f13623b9d0c134e386e4